Inspiring Others

Atiya Johnson continues to inspire others with her story and makes an impact in not only women’s empowerment, but shows excellence through diversity, and continues to demonstrate that with grit and determination, you can make a great difference no matter what obstacles seem to challenge you!
Over the past 20 years, Atiya has maintained a thriving salon, has been married to the love of her life, Dwayne Johnson for over 17 years while raising their 3 tenacious children, created her own hair care product line, became a published author of “F*** the Naysayers”: A guide to being a Fierce Unapologetic Committed Queen and has most recently broken the glass ceiling by opening the first black owned and operated cosmetology school in New Jersey! Although she was met with much resistance while opening the school for over 3 years by local and state leaders, Atiya remained determined, passionate, unapologetic to wanting change in her community, and graceful throughout the entire process. The mission of helping her community, educating people from diverse backgrounds, and servicing people with a contagious smile outweighed any roadblocks that the naysayers presented. Throughout her life, at times, she may have doubted her ability, been underestimated, and challenged to become the person that she is today! However, Atiya Johnson has not only earned a “seat at the table”, she has created her own powerful table and continues to strive to invite other strong, passionate, and driven individuals to grab their chair!
